Choose random functions f1, f2, f3, . . . independently and uniformly from among the nn functions from [n] into [n]. For t > 1, let gt = ft ◦ ft−1 ◦ · · · ◦ f1 be the composition of the first t functions, and let T be the smallest t for which gt is constant(i.e. gt(i) = gt(j) for all i, j). The goal of this paper is to determine the asymptotic distribution of T . We prove that, for any positive...

In their review of gelatin tannate (GT) Ruszczyński et al [1] extensively explain tannic acid (TA) activity and they may give the impression that TA is responsible for the mechanism of action of GT and also responsible for the possible adverse effects of the product. Various in vivo studies have demonstrated that GT is a stable complex not dissociated in the small intestine. Therefore any refer...
